本月博客排行
-
第1名
龙儿筝 -
第2名
lerf -
第3名
fantaxy025025 - johnsmith9th
- xiangjie88
- zysnba
年度博客排行
-
第1名
青否云后端云 -
第2名
宏天软件 -
第3名
gashero - wy_19921005
- vipbooks
- benladeng5225
- e_e
- wallimn
- javashop
- ranbuijj
- fantaxy025025
- jickcai
- gengyun12
- zw7534313
- qepwqnp
- 解宜然
- ssydxa219
- zysnba
- sam123456gz
- sichunli_030
- arpenker
- tanling8334
- gaojingsong
- kaizi1992
- xpenxpen
- 龙儿筝
- jh108020
- wiseboyloves
- ganxueyun
- xyuma
- xiangjie88
- wangchen.ily
- Jameslyy
- luxurioust
- lemonhandsome
- mengjichen
- jbosscn
- zxq_2017
- lzyfn123
- nychen2000
- forestqqqq
- wjianwei666
- ajinn
- zhanjia
- Xeden
- hanbaohong
- java-007
- 喧嚣求静
- mwhgJava
- kingwell.leng
最新文章列表
[IOS]textView自动滚动到底部
UITextView text content doesn't start from the top
参考:https://stackoverflow.com/questions/26835944/uitextview-text-content-doesnt-start-from-the-top
我使用的是这种方法:
override func viewWillAppear ...
自己总结的类目Category
-------------------------给UILabel设置字体,font----------------------------------
#import <UIKit/UIKit.h>
#pragma mark ======自带的根据url获取image的方法=======
@interface UIImageView (DispatchLoad)
- ...
TextView添加placeholder属性
@interface SSTextView : UITextView {
BOOL _shouldDrawPlaceholder;
}
/**
The string that is displayed when there is no other text in the text view.
The default value is `nil`.
* ...
ios 弹出键盘上面带UITextView 的评论界面
.h里面写的两个属性。
//评论的时候弹出来的。
@property (retain, nonatomic) UIView *mainView;
@property (retain, nonatomic) UITextView *myTextV1;
ViewDidLoad 里面写的。
[[NSNotificationCenterdefaultCenter] addObserv ...
UITextView 带有PlaceHolder
#import <UIKit/UIKit.h>
#import <Foundation/Foundation.h>
@interface UIPlaceHolderTextView : UITextView
@property (nonatomic, retain) NSString *placeholder;
@property (nonatomic, r ...
设置UITextView的圆角
一般情况下,我们看到的UITextView都是方角的:
将UITextView的方角转成圆角:
#import <QuartzCore/QuartzCore.h>
[self.textView.layer setCornerRadius:10]
UITextView
一开始用UILineBreakModeWordWrap时,发现中英文混合,用sizeWithFont高度不是很精确;后来改为UILineBreakModeCharacterWrap就OK了;
下面是UILineBreakMode的说明:
typedef enum { UILineBreakModeWordWrap = 0, UILineBreakModeCharacte ...
IOS之UILabel显示内容自动换行
1、UILabel内容自动换行
UIFont *fontName = [UIFont systemFontOfSize:16.0f];
//定义字体大小
CGSize sizeName = [orderFood.food_name
sizeWithFont:fontName constrainedToSize:CGSizeMake(130.0f,MAXFLOAT) lineBreakMod ...
UILabel UITextField UITextView区别
UILabel 显示的文本只读,无法编辑,可以根据文字个数自动换行;
UITextField 可编辑本文,但是无法换行,只能在一行显示;当点击键盘上的return时会收到一个事件做一些事情。
UITextView 可编辑文本,提供换行功能。
UITextView高度自适应
HPTextViewInternal.h
#import <UIKit/UIKit.h>
@interface HPTextViewInternal : UITextView {
}
@end
HPTextViewInternal.m
#import "HPTextViewInternal.h"
@imple ...
iOS:UITextView中return key点击事件的监听方法
可以这样解决,在- (BOOL)textView:(UITextView *)textView shouldChangeTextInRange:(NSRange)range replacementText:(NSString *)text中监听replacementText,如果为回车则将键盘收起
- (BOOL)textView:(UITextView *)textView sh ...
UITextView限制输入长度
例如限制只能输入150个字符,可以通过UITextViewDelegate中的- (BOOL)textView:(UITextView *)textView shouldChangeTextInRange:(NSRange)range replacementText:(NSString *)text;来实现。
- (BOOL)textView:(UITextView *)textView s ...
改变UITextView的高度
有一个320*480的UITextView,点击UITextView的时候,下面的部分会被弹出的软键盘挡住,我们可以将UITextView的高度改为480 - 软键盘的高度,关闭软键盘后,高度恢复为原始高度。
- (void)viewDidLoad
{
[super viewDidLoad];
self.textView = [[UITextView alloc] initW ...
实现对UITextField ,UITextView等输入框的 字数限制
1. 如何实现对UITextField ,UITextView等输入框的 字数限制
(1)首先,肯定要 让controller 实现 UITextFieldDelegate (针对UITextField)或者 UITex ...
UITextView自定义文字选择后的菜单
- (void)viewDidLoad {
[super viewDidLoad];
UIMenuItem *menuItem = [[UIMenuItem alloc] initWithTitle:@"分享到新浪微博" action:@selector(shareSina)];
UIMenuController *menu = [UIMenuController s ...
UITextView显示HTML内容,实现显示不同的字体和文字颜色
[textView setContentToHTMLString:txtStr];
<html>
<head>
</head>
<body>
<img src = "http://t1.baidu.com/it/u=1075557596,3331641536&fm=15&gp=0.jpg& ...